1. The service
SwiftWill provides legal information and document-preparation software for England and Wales: a guided online interview, rules-based validation of your answers, and a personalised will PDF delivered instantly with a signing instruction card. SwiftWill is not a law firm and does not provide legal advice. Nothing in the service creates a solicitor–client relationship.
2. Jurisdiction
The service produces documents valid only in England and Wales. Customers with addresses in Scotland or Northern Ireland are excluded before payment; if you purchase despite a non-England-and-Wales address, the document may not be valid and you should contact us for a refund.

4. Free lifetime updates
Your one-time payment includes free updates for life: re-open your interview, change your answers, and regenerate your will PDF at any time, as often as you like, at no charge. Each regenerated will must be printed and signed with two witnesses to be valid, and you should destroy superseded signed originals.

6. The solicitor-review add-on
If purchased, a qualified SRA-regulated solicitor reviews your completed will within 3 working days; any correction the review requires regenerates your PDF free of charge. Delivery of your will is still instant — the review happens afterwards. The review gives you Legal Ombudsman recourse for the reviewed will via the reviewing solicitor's regulation.
7. Your responsibilities
- Answer the interview honestly and completely; the document can only be as accurate as your answers.
- Sign the printed will correctly — wet ink, two independent witnesses — following the included card; an unsigned or wrongly signed will is not valid.
- Tell us if your situation triggers any suitability-check redirect; those situations need a solicitor.
- Keep your account email accessible; it is how updates and regenerated documents reach you.
8. Liability
We carry £2m professional indemnity insurance. Nothing in these terms excludes liability that cannot be excluded by law (including for death or personal injury caused by negligence, or for fraud). Subject to that, our aggregate liability is limited to the greater of the amount you paid and the cover available under our professional indemnity insurance, and we are not liable for indirect or consequential losses. Because validity depends on correct signing — which happens offline, with your witnesses — we cannot be responsible for execution errors, which is why every delivery includes emphatic signing instructions.
